WebJun 30, 2024 · Place a soft pillow between body parts so they can help with skin irritation. If you need to lay on your side it is best to use a pillow that sits between your ankles or knees to help reduce irritation. If you lay on your back place a pillow under your heels. Under your calves so it helps to lift your heels.
